What is British Pound (GBP)

The British Pound, often abbreviated as GBP, is the official currency of the United Kingdom and some of its territories. It is one of the oldest currencies still in use today, with roots tracing back to the 8th century. The symbol for the British Pound is £, which comes from the Latin word "libra," referring to a unit of weight. The pound is subdivided into 100 pence (singular: penny).

The GBP is known for its stability and is one of the most traded currencies globally. As a major international reserve currency, it plays a significant role in global trade and finance. The Bank of England, the central bank of the UK, is responsible for issuing banknotes and controlling monetary policy. Factors affecting the value of the British Pound include interest rates, economic indicators, and geopolitical stability.

What is Costa Rica Colon (CRC)

The Costa Rican Colon, abbreviated as CRC, is the official currency of Costa Rica. The colon was first introduced in 1896, replacing the Costa Rican peso. The currency is named after Christopher Columbus, known in Spanish as "Cristóbal Colón." The symbol for the colon is ₡, and it is subdivided into 100 centimos.

The Costa Rican Colon is distinct due to its vibrant banknotes and coins featuring local wildlife and historical figures, reflecting the country's rich culture and biodiversity. The Central Bank of Costa Rica is responsible for regulating the currency, managing inflation, and ensuring economic stability. The CRC's value can fluctuate due to various factors, including inflation rates, trade balance, and political factors.
